Effects of Dehulling and Extrusion‐Cooking on the Nutritional and Physicochemical Properties of Navy Bean (Phaseolus vulgaris L.) Flours

open access: yesChemFoodChem, EarlyView.
Dehulling combined with twin‐screw extrusion improves the nutritional and functional properties of steam treated navy beans. Protein digestibility increases while phytic acid is reduced by 43% and trypsin inhibitors are inactivated. Enhanced expansion, solubility, and sensory quality highlight the potential of dehulled bean flours for developing ...

Sunlight‐Driven Green Synthesis of Platinum Nanoparticles From Double‐Vacancy Halide Perovskite Precursors for Methanol Reforming

open access: yesChemistry – A European Journal, EarlyView.
Sunlight‐driven synthesis offers a green and energy‐efficient route to metallic nanoparticles. Here, double‐vacancy halide perovskites (Cs2PtX6, X = Cl, Br) act as photoactive precursors for the in‐situ formation of ultrasmall (< 3 nm) platinum nanoparticles under simulated sunlight at room temperature.

Green and sustainable synthesis of magnetite from copper slag via citrate complexation for methylene blue dye removal from water

open access: yesThe Canadian Journal of Chemical Engineering, EarlyView.
Abstract This study proposes a novel, green, and sustainable method for synthesizing magnetic iron oxides from metallurgical copper slag (CS), leveraging its iron content as a valuable resource. Iron was extracted via acid leaching using edible citric acid (ECA), forming a citrate–iron complex (CSL), which was subsequently thermally decomposed at 300°C
